The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 2003 PDQ 32 is a popular catamaran known for its performance and cruising comfort. Here are some of the key pros and cons:
Pros
Spacious Interior: The PDQ 32 offers a roomy and well-designed living space, maximizing comfort for extended cruising.
Solid Build Quality: Known for sturdy construction, the 2003 model features a robust fiberglass hull and deck.
Good Sailing Performance: With its efficient sail plan and twin keels, the PDQ 32 handles well both upwind and downwind.
Shallow Draft: The catamaran’s shallow draft allows access to shallower anchorages and coastal cruising areas.
Easy to Handle: Twin engines and a simple rig make docking and maneuvering straightforward, ideal for short-handed sailing.
Ample Storage: Plenty of storage compartments for gear and supplies enhance the liveaboard experience.
Cons
Limited Privacy: As a 32-foot catamaran, the layout can feel somewhat compact, with less separation between cabins.
Aging Systems: Being a 2003 model, some onboard systems and equipment may require updating or maintenance.
Performance in Heavy Weather: While stable, the PDQ 32 may not perform as well as larger catamarans in very rough seas.
Limited Market Availability: Compared to newer models, fewer 2003 PDQ 32s are available, which can affect resale value.
Interior Finish: Some owners note that the interior finish is functional but less refined compared to newer or larger cruising catamarans.
